Understanding the Basics of a 30-Year Fixed-Rate Mortgage (FRM)

What Is a Fixed-Rate Mortgage?

A Fixed-Rate Mortgage (FRM) is a type of home loan where the interest rate remains constant throughout the duration of the loan term. Unlike adjustable-rate mortgages (ARMs), which fluctuate with market interest rates, an FRM offers stability and predictable monthly payments, making budgeting easier for homeowners.

Key Features of a 30-Year FRM

  • Loan Term: 30 years (360 months)
  • Interest Rate: Fixed at 6% annually
  • Loan Amount: $100,000
  • Repayment Schedule: Monthly amortized payments
  • Total Repayment Period: 30 years
This structure allows borrowers to spread out payments over a lengthy period, reducing the size of each monthly installment while maintaining fixed payment amounts, which is especially beneficial for long-term financial planning.

Calculating Monthly Mortgage Payments

The Mortgage Payment Formula

The calculation of monthly mortgage payments in a fixed-rate loan uses the amortization formula:

\[
M = P \times \frac{r(1 + r)^n}{(1 + r)^n - 1}
\]

Where:


  • M = Monthly payment

  • P = Principal loan amount ($100,000)

  • r = Monthly interest rate (annual rate divided by 12 months)

  • n = Total number of payments (loan term in months)


Applying the Formula to Our Scenario


Given:

  • Principal, P = $100,000

  • Annual interest rate = 6% = 0.06

  • Monthly interest rate, r = 0.06 / 12 = 0.005 (or 0.5%)

  • Number of payments, n = 30 years × 12 months = 360 months


Plugging these into the formula:

\[
M = 100,000 \times \frac{0.005 \times (1 + 0.005)^{360}}{(1 + 0.005)^{360} - 1}
\]

Calculating step-by-step:


  1. \( (1 + 0.005)^{360} \approx 6.022575 \)

  2. Numerator: \( 0.005 \times 6.022575 \approx 0.0301129 \)

  3. Denominator: \( 6.022575 - 1 = 5.022575 \)


Final calculation:
\[
M = 100,000 \times \frac{0.0301129}{5.022575} \approx 100,000 \times 0.005996 \approx \$599.60
\]

Monthly Payment: Approximately \$599.60

This payment includes both principal and interest, structured to fully amortize the loan over 30 years.

Key Benefits and Considerations of a 30-Year FRM Loan

Advantages

  • Predictable Payments: Fixed interest rate ensures consistent monthly payments.
  • Long Repayment Period: Smaller monthly payments compared to shorter-term loans, easing cash flow management.
  • Stability: No surprises with fluctuating interest rates.
  • Build Equity: Gradual equity buildup through principal repayment.

Potential Drawbacks

  • Interest Costs: Higher total interest paid over the life of the loan compared to shorter terms.
  • Slower Equity Accumulation: Takes longer to build significant equity in the property.
  • Opportunity Cost: Funds allocated to interest could potentially be invested elsewhere.

Important Considerations for Borrowers

  1. Affordability: Ensure the monthly payment aligns with your income and budget.
  2. Interest Rate Environment: Locking in at 6% is beneficial if market rates are higher; consider refinancing if rates drop.
  3. Loan Fees and Closing Costs: Factor in additional costs associated with obtaining the mortgage.
  4. Prepayment Options: Check if you can make extra payments or pay off the loan early without penalties to reduce total interest paid.

Additional Financial Aspects of the Loan

Impact on Total Cost and Affordability

While the monthly payment of roughly \$599.60 seems manageable, the total cost over 30 years is significant due to accumulated interest. Homebuyers should evaluate whether the property value and their financial situation justify such a long-term commitment.

Tax Implications

In many countries, mortgage interest may be tax-deductible, which can reduce effective borrowing costs. Always consult a tax advisor to understand applicable deductions.

Refinancing Opportunities

Refinancing can be a strategic move if interest rates decline significantly below 6%. This might involve replacing the existing loan with a new one at a lower rate, reducing monthly payments and total interest paid.

Implications of Early Repayment

Making extra payments toward principal can shorten the loan term and save on interest costs. However, always check for prepayment penalties or fees before doing so.
